Fast food restaurants in West Roxbury, Massachusetts

Find Fast food restaurants in West Roxbury, Massachusetts near you now.

DeNo's Pizza & Subs

DeNo's Pizza & Subs

2040 Centre St, West Roxbury, MA 02132, United States